Summary
Public Service Pays Off Act This bill requires the Department of Education to incrementally cancel a percentage of the obligation to repay the balance on eligible Federal Direct Loans for a borrower who, while employed in public service, makes qualifying payments for 2, 4, 6, 8, and 10 years.
